    Strengths: Cheap, looks nice, and stacks with other similar lacie drives.

    Weaknesses:Ugly and hot power brick, very short USB cable. Run very hot if left on for long periods of time.

    Overall Evaluation: I\\\\\\\'ve bought 2 of these 250Gb drives over the past few years. Mainly because they look nice and are real cheap. Both are still running just fine. Reading a lot of these reviews I get the impression that people leave them on 24 hours a day, whether they use them or not. Thats why so many people complain that they die. With my 2 drives I keep the power switch off whenever I dont use them. This 1) Saves power and 2) saves the drive. I only turn them on when I need to backup everything on my system, or to copy files on and off. So they usually get about 1-2 hours of use per week. Doing that, I have not had any problems. Overall a good drive for the price, but if you want one that you will leave on and use all the time, this isnt the drive for you.

    Strengths: Price

    Weaknesses:They fail... consistently. Just read the posts.

    Overall Evaluation: Listen, I like a deal like everyone else here on Pricegrabber. I do the math and I compare the prices and consistently LaCie drives are the best bang for the buck. But are they really?Simply put, I've owned two of these and within, or just after a year of use, BOTH have failed. It's that simple. If the failure falls within the year warranty, and assuming you purchased it from one of their "authorized" resellers (and can prove it), they'll replace it fairly hassle free. Over a year, and you are SOL, as they say.I used mine for daily back up and media storage. Once the first failed and was replaced under warranty, (thinking it was a fluke), I bought another and started mirroring the two drives for redundancy. I'm glad I did.Life expectancy of drives varies. I'd say it's safe to expect 3-5 years. With that said, I've owned and built my own computers since 95 and have only had one drive failure and that was on a 5 year old machine. As for those who say that external drives are not intended to be run 24/7, I don't buy that. In my opinion, a well designed external drive should be able to run just as well as an internal drive.There's really not much more I can say about these drives. Ascetically they're nice enough to look at & they're fairly quiet. But again, what does any of that matter if they FAIL. They FAIL.
